摘要

Data on radioactivity in the thyroid,urine,serum,butanol-extractable iodine (BEI) and chromatographic fractionations of BEI,obtained during four I-131therapeutic treatments of a T sub 3 -thyrotoxic patient,have been analyzed and simulated with the help of a 7-compartment model. Good fits to most of the data can be obtained with both the dose-independent and dose-dependent models. A model with 3or 4compartments,which provides adequate fits to iodine kinetic data in most euthyroid and hyperthyroid patients is not satisfactory in the case of this patient. Thus,to represent iodine metabolism during T sub 3 -thyrotoxicosis therapy,we find that it is necessary to provide for separate biochemical pathways for the BEI components as well as the butanol-insoluble compounds released by the thyroid gland.
